Transaction 8104cd69fd122e8b9febcaa892611e7415734b10592a58b39a440a6667899624

1 Input
2 Outputs
  • 8104cd69fd122e8b9febcaa892611e7415734b10592a58b39a440a6667899624:0
  • value  478447300
    address  2MspcrVX7229vDhCt2FqqT94tRAtAGLj4fK
  • 8104cd69fd122e8b9febcaa892611e7415734b10592a58b39a440a6667899624:1
  • value  3557529
    address  2NE6sXgR2BoYCw5dtZKUiDtXsExF8cuZwsT